Output 4ab5651c5ee445e5f8ea25e3cc7f433c729e01e2e15cfb0e1fcfd6364fbf2a6f:0

value
622300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a0c95eb25e0c21a25e30c87b55e56ddd658a3c OP_EQUAL
address
398dGjM5HXyYUyEACkQ4awNhT971Zam5qC
transaction
4ab5651c5ee445e5f8ea25e3cc7f433c729e01e2e15cfb0e1fcfd6364fbf2a6f
confirmations
328006
spent
true